‘Dancing On Ice’: ‘Great British Bake Off’ Winner Candice Brown, Jake Quickenden And Max Evans Sign Up

Three more stars have joined the ‘Dancing On Ice’ line-up, with Candice Brown, Max Evans and Jake Quickenden being confirmed for the show on Wednesday (1 November).

All three had been previously rumoured to be taking part, with the first two confirming the news on Chris Evans’ Radio 2 breakfast show.

Max said: “I haven’t done any skating since I was a kid, and this is completely different having to skate on live television.

“I’ve had two training sessions which have hurt my feet a lot. We’ve all had a dance, which is familiar territory, but skating is so not…”

Candice will get her skates on for the first time later today and admitted: “It’s nerve-wracking. My friends call me Bambi on Ice and that’s just normal day to day!”

Following this announcement, former ‘X Factor’ singer Jake became the sixth star confirmed for the line-up, as confirmed during an interview on ‘Lorraine’.

Jake is no stranger to reality TV, and after putting ‘The X Factor’ behind him in 2014, went on to star in both ‘I’m A Celebrity’ and the most recent series of ‘The Jump’.

A total of 12 celebrities will be taking part in the series when it returns to our screens in early 2018.

So far, the line-up includes a former ‘Love Island’ contestant, a ‘Coronation Street’ star and, last but absolutely not least, a member of Bucks Fizz. The other stars taking part will be named in the coming weeks.

Holly Willoughby and Phillip Schofield will return to host the show while Jayne Torvill and Christopher Dean will make the switch from acting as coaches for the celebs, to becoming judges alongside Jason Gardiner.

A fourth judge – potentially Ashley Banjo – is also set to be confirmed in the coming months.
